Uriel Corfa 626d29c938 Add support to create Repository objects lazily in MainClass.
This lets users do the following without issuing an unnecessary request:

issues_of_my_repository = g.get_repo('PyGithub/PyGithub').get_issues()

Since the GithubObject layer handles laziness transparently, lazy
loading is enabled by default, and can be disabled via the `lazy`
kwarg. This does not affect any test except tests that pertain to
caching or laziness itself.

Tyler Treat 0ddfaaca01 Implement support for getting repo by id
This allows the Github class to retrieve repos by either their full name
or id. If the user passes in an id for a repo which doesn't exist or in which
they don't have sufficient permissions, an UnknownObjectException will
be raised. This addresses issue #245.
